Printer cartridges are a highly demanded product which is no surprise when the world has become increasingly computer reliant. With word processed documents being the norm and home photo printers becoming more popular, to name just two common uses, the usefulness of ink cartridges cannot be denied. However, although they serve a necessary function, the number being thrown away is extortionate when adopting an environmental point of view. The cost of throwing away empty printer cartridges is high. Around three hundred million are discarded a year and these end up in land fill sites. Unfortunately the plastic they are made from is non-biodegradable so contribute greatly to environmental problems as a result of this. This is why it is important to reuse ink cartridges through the refilling process.
Printer cartridge refilling kits are widely available. To begin, a syringe needs ti be filled with one of the printer ink colours. To prevent any stains this should be undertaken over a sink or scrap material. The amount of ink an ink cartridge can hold varies from printer to printer but is usually stated in the instructions. In the top of the container make a small hole for each colour chamber and then insert the needle of the syringe. When filling the cartridge avoiding any air getting into the chamber is important as this causes it to foam. To prevent this, the ink must be transferred very slowly. It is not necessary to seal the holes made with the needle as there will already be existing holes for the ink to ‘breathe’. Carefully clean or dispose of the syringe needle and place the ink cartridges back in the printer. To check the printer ink has been successfully refilled, run the cleaning cycle a few times to check for gaps.
